log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

redis 对单个key进行大数据量incr

利用 redis incr 做超高并发延迟累加器(一亿数量级)前景提要:公司有一个字段,需要支持 qps 为 1000万。 但是可以将结果作为延迟结果发送过来,比如 20秒发一次结果。但是不能直接 incr 1000万次,redis即使是集群 也扛不住。提示: redis只有在网络读取请求利用了多线程,在磁盘io等处理数据方面依然是单线程。思路: 多应用示例部署,利用多应用本地jvm缓存,来进行分

#java#redis#缓存 +1
Zuul入门实战(完整版)

11 Zuul学习11.1 为什么要使用微服务网关经过上面的学习,微服务架构已经初具雏形,但还有一些问题,不同的微服务一般会有不同的网络地址,而外部客户端(例如手机APP)可能需要调用多个服务的接口才能完成一个业务需求。例如一个电影购票的手机APP,可能会调用多个微服务的接口,才能完成一次购票的业务流程。如果让客户端直接与各个微服务通信,会有以下的问题:客户端会多次请求不同的微服务,增加了客户端的

#spring#spring boot
docker 如何部署springboot项目并连接mysql、redis容器

首先我们先了解一下docker中的网络配置18 网络基础配置大量的互联网应用服务包括多个服务组件,这往往需要多个容器之间通过网络通信进行相互配合。Docker目前提供了映射容器端口到宿主主机和容器互联机制来为容器提供网络服务。下面学习如何使用Docker的网络功能。包括使用端口映射机制来将容器内应用服务提供给外部网络,以及通过容器互联系统让多个容器之间进行快捷的网络通信。18.1 端口映射实现访问

#网络#docker#java +2
docker 如何部署springboot项目并连接mysql、redis容器

首先我们先了解一下docker中的网络配置18 网络基础配置大量的互联网应用服务包括多个服务组件,这往往需要多个容器之间通过网络通信进行相互配合。Docker目前提供了映射容器端口到宿主主机和容器互联机制来为容器提供网络服务。下面学习如何使用Docker的网络功能。包括使用端口映射机制来将容器内应用服务提供给外部网络,以及通过容器互联系统让多个容器之间进行快捷的网络通信。18.1 端口映射实现访问

#网络#docker#java +2
Flink同一个DataStream同时供多个业务使用

一:背景我们项目中用到Flink的Java客户端 用来做数据处理数据源:kafka发送源:kafka原来只有一个业务需求,可以理解为对mq消息中的一个字段做累计和。现在又多了两个业务需求,可以理解为对mq消息的其他字段做累加和。此时面临的问题是:flink 做完类似于 map filter keyby reduce等算子操作时,是否只能为一个业务使用?如果可以供多个业务使用数据源,则我们不需要考虑

#flink#kafka#java
SpringCloud入门(总体认识)

SpringCloud入门(总体认识)1.学习目标​Ø 了解系统架构的演变​Ø 了解RPC与Http的区别​Ø 掌握HttpURLConnection的简单使用​Ø 掌握HttpClient的简单使用​Ø 知道什么是SpringCloud​Ø 独立搭建Eureka注册中心​Ø 掌握Eureka高可用性​Ø 熟悉负载均衡的概念​Ø 使用Ribbon做负载均衡​Ø 使用Feign做声明式调用​Ø 使用

#spring#分布式#java
Mysql 大批量删除数据(解决方案)

Mysql 大批量删除数据参考微信公众号《Java自学之路》在业务场景要求高的数据库中,对于单条删除或者更新的操作,在delete和update后面加上limit1是个好习惯。我在工作中看到有同事这样写,如果想要了解具体细节,请参考Mysql全面总结为什么这样做?比如在执行删除中,如果第一条就命中了删除行,如果Sql中有limit1;这时候就直接return了,否则还会执行完全表扫描才return

#数据库#mysql
    共 11 条
  • 1
  • 2
  • 请选择